Process composition
Printing (red glue / solder paste) --> detection (optional AOI automatic or visual inspection) --> placement (first paste small devices and then paste large devices: divided into high-speed placement and integrated circuit placement) --> detection (optional AOI optical / visual inspection) --> welding (using hot air reflow soldering for welding) --> detection (can be divided into AOI optical inspection appearance and functional test detection) --> maintenance ( Use tools: soldering table and hot air desoldering table, etc.)--> board separation (manual or board separator for cutting board)Process flow is simplified to: printing ------- patch ------- welding ------- overhaul (each process can be added to the detection link to control the quality)
Solder Paste Printing
The role is to print the solder paste at an angle of 45 degrees with a squeegee onto the pads of the PCB, in preparation for the soldering of the components. The equipment used is the printing machine (solder paste printing machine), located in the forefront of SMT production line.
Part placement
Its role is to accurately install the surface assembly components to the PCB's fixed position. The equipment used is the mounter, located behind the printing machine in the SMT production line, and is generally a high-speed machine and a general-purpose machine used in accordance with production requirements.
Reflow soldering
Its role is to melt the solder paste, so that the surface assembly components and PCB firmly welded together. The equipment used is reflow oven, located in the SMT production line behind the bonder, for temperature requirements are quite strict, the need for real-time temperature measurement, the measured temperature in the form of a profile to reflect.
AOI Optical Inspection
Its role is to detect the solder quality of the soldered PCB. The equipment used is an automatic optical inspection machine (AOI), the location of which can be configured at the right place in the production line according to the needs of the inspection. Some before reflow soldering, some after reflow soldering.
Repair
Its role is to detect malfunctioning PCBs for rework. The tools used are soldering irons, rework workstations, etc. Configured after the AOI optical inspection.
Depanelization
Its role is to cut the multi-linked PCBA, so that it is separated into separate individuals, generally using V-cut and machine cutting method.
Basic knowledge
Solder paste is a paste made by mixing solder powder with paste solder with flux function, usually the solder powder accounts for about 90% and the rest is chemical composition.
We call the object that can change its form at will or divide it arbitrarily a fluid, and the science of studying the laws and characteristics of fluid deformation and flow behavior caused by external forces is called rheology. However, in engineering, the concept of viscosity is used to characterize the magnitude of fluid viscosity.
Rheological Behavior of Solder Paste
Solder paste is mixed with a certain amount of thixotropic agent and has pseudoplastic fluid properties. Solder paste in the printing, the role of the squeegee thrust, its viscosity decreases, when reaching the window of the template, the viscosity reaches its lowest, so it can smoothly through the window to the PCB pad, with the cessation of the external force, the solder paste viscosity and quickly back up, so there will be no collapse of the printed graphics and diffuse flow, to get a good printing effect.
Factors affecting the viscosity of the solder paste: solder powder content; solder powder particle size; temperature; shear rate.
1、Solder powder content: the increase of solder powder in the solder paste caused by the increase of viscosity.
2, solder powder particle size: solder powder particle size increases, viscosity decreases.
3, temperature: temperature increases, viscosity decreases. The best ambient temperature for printing is 23±3 degrees.
